Top Picks: Solomon & Eredrim
Solomon remains a favorite for its accessibility, with a player stating, "Solomon is undoubtedly the best shell for players who arenโt extremely super good." Eredrim is praised for its large health pool, making it a dependable choice for new players. A recent comment confirmed, "Eredrim has carried me through 95% of the game."
Combat Strategy Tips
Players emphasize that effective combat requires understanding each shell's strengths. One combat strategy involves Tiel: "the heavy hit+harden+light hit+roll away combo works for all the bosses including the final boss!" Utilizing Eredrim with the hammer and chisel setup was also noted as a successful approach.

๐ก๏ธ Eredrim excels in survivability with the largest health bar.
โ๏ธ Solomon remains user-friendly and accessible early on.
๐ฅ Tiel offers agility but demands stamina management.
